What is CVE-2024-47120?
A vulnerability exists in IBM Security Verify Information Queue versions 10.0.5 to 10.0.8 that allows a privileged user to escalate their privileges due to containers operating with excessive permissions. This could lead to an increased attack surface, potentially compromising the security of the host system. Organizations should assess their deployments and apply recommended patches to mitigate risks associated with this vulnerability.
